Additional information:
Only son of the late Maj. General and Mrs. Hitchins, of East Lodge, Belmont, Hove, Sussex. Twice Mentioned in Despatches for Gallant and Distinguished Service at the Capture of Givenchy, 20th Dec., 1914, and at Ypres, April, 1915. "The gallant Colonel of The gallant Manchesters" was respected and beloved for his noble and unselfish character, and for his conspicuous bravery.
